Zentrale Unterschiede: Australia vs South Africa
- •FIFA Ranking: Australia sit 35 places higher on the FIFA ranking (#24 vs #59).
- •Squad Chemistry: Australia have stronger squad cohesion (71/100 vs 68/100).
- •Average Squad Rating: South Africa carry the higher average player rating (6.8 vs 6.6).
- •International Experience: Australia bring more combined caps to the squad (617 vs 430).
- •World Cup Titles: Neither side has won a World Cup; both are chasing a first title in 2026.

Was bedeuten diese Werte?
- Chemistry — Wie gut die Mannschaft als Einheit zusammenspielt. Denk an das Tiki-Taka des FC Barcelona im Vergleich zu einer zufällig zusammengewürfelten All-Star-Truppe.
- Vertrautheit — Wie lange diese Spieler schon zusammenspielen. Kader mit jahrelanger gemeinsamer Erfahrung lesen die Laufwege der anderen instinktiv.
- Stabilität — Wie beständig taktisches System und Aufstellung waren. Häufige Trainerwechsel und Formationsexperimente schaden diesem Wert.
- Moral — Das aktuelle Selbstvertrauen und Momentum des Kaders. Jüngste Siege, Rückhalt der Fans und positive Medienstimmung tragen alle dazu bei.

What is the World Cup history of Australia versus South Africa?
Australia have appeared in 6 FIFA World Cups and won 0 titles; South Africa have appeared in 4 World Cups and won 0 titles. Australia's best finish is Round of 16; South Africa's best finish is Group stage.
